// Plugin authors: the Copperline queue compacts logs every six hours,
// so any consumer offset older than the compaction horizon will be
// reset to the earliest retained record. Design your plugins to be
// idempotent on replay. The compaction status endpoint requires
// authentication; the client below passes the internal service key
// that follows on the next line.

service key, yadug-bajog: zpat3_pou

Release checklist — FeedLark Validator 3.2

Before publishing your plugin against the new validator, confirm it passes the full conformance suite, including the stricter enclosure-length checks introduced in this release. Plugins that rewrite episode GUIDs must now declare the `guid-rewrite` capability in their manifest, or validation will fail with a capability error. Test against both RSS and the Lark-JSON feed format, since the validator now runs both paths by default. When filing a compatibility report, include the token printed below.

pipeline stamp: htk21_117f26d8d4a22b34e7542

Handover — tailgrep CLI

For the security review: tailgrep is our internal CLI for tailing production logs on the Fernwick cluster. Access is normally broker-gated, but a break-glass path exists for auditor use when the broker is down. That path logs every session and requires a dedicated recovery passphrase, recorded immediately below for your assessment.

unlock words, faweg-fahop: wendor-kelmir-ulaeth-holael

14:20 — Cutover from the legacy Queuewright scheduler to Taskfall completed. Plugin hooks on the old enqueue path were disabled; authors must migrate to the new dispatch API before the next minor release. Retry semantics changed: at-least-once only. No data loss observed during replay. The cutover build carries the token noted below.

pipeline stamp: htk31_f769b577b3028a4e9958e5bb8d1259a

Before promoting the Mistvale release, trigger each serverless handler once via the warmup endpoint to absorb cold-start latency; initial invocations load the policy bundle and can exceed the 3-second security timeout, which would otherwise be logged as a failed health check. Confirm that the warmup invocations complete with policy verification enabled — do not disable verification to speed this up, as that would mask tampered bundles. Once all handlers report warm and verified, register the deploy key shown below with the gateway.

signing key of bagap-yawep = bky13_TbfT6ZMUoGJo2